I was born in Macau SAR and later moved to Australia in 2013. 

I have been playing harp for around twelve years and piano for twenty one years.  I studied harp with Ms Louise Johnson and graduated from the Sydney Conservatorium of Music with a Bachelor of Music Performance in 2019. I completed Associate diploma in Piano performance from Trinity College London in 2011 and Licentiate diploma in Harp Performance from AMEB in 2019.  I was the recipient of many music scholarships during my studies.

I have been regular piano accompanist for choirs, school and instrumental examinations. As a harpist, I play regularly in special occasions and commercial events. In 2022 I was selected to be the soloist with Fremantle Symphony Orchestra playing "Harp Concerto in Bb". 

I was the highest scorer of ABRSM Harp Exam in Macau in 2013 & 2014. I have been guest harpist in many orchestras in Australia and Macao SAR, including the Ku-ringgai Symphony Orchestra, Sydney university Wind Orchestra, Fremantle Symphony Orchestra, Metropolitan Symphony Orchestra.  I was grateful to be the winner of the Gold Medal in Hong Kong Open Music Competition in 2018 and First prize of Sydney Harp Eisteddford in 2019.
